]> git.donarmstrong.com Git - lilypond.git/blob - Documentation/fr/notation/input.itely
Thinko in tablature-tremolo.ly regtest.
[lilypond.git] / Documentation / fr / notation / input.itely
1 @c -*- coding: utf-8; mode: texinfo; documentlanguage: fr -*-
2
3 @ignore
4     Translation of GIT committish: dd41d8981e1e7c4255ae155f03822f893048c55d
5
6     When revising a translation, copy the HEAD committish of the
7     version that you are working on.  For details, see the Contributors'
8     Guide, node Updating translation committishes..
9 @end ignore
10
11 @c \version "2.12.0"
12
13 @c Translators: Jean-Charles Malahieude, Valentin Villenave
14
15 @node Généralités en matière d'entrée et sortie
16 @chapter Généralités en matière d'entrée et sortie
17 @translationof General input and output
18
19 @untranslated
20
21
22 @menu
23 * Structure de fichier::             
24 * Titres et entêtes::          
25 * Travail sur des fichiers texte::    
26 * Contrôle des sorties::          
27 * Sortie MIDI::                 
28 @end menu
29
30 @node Structure de fichier
31 @section Structure de fichier
32 @translationof Input structure
33
34 @untranslated
35
36
37 @menu
38 * Structure d'une partition::        
39 * Plusieurs partitions dans un même ouvrage::   
40 * Structure de fichier::              
41 @end menu
42
43 @node Structure d'une partition
44 @subsection Structure d'une partition
45 @translationof Structure of a score
46
47 @untranslated
48
49
50 @node Plusieurs partitions dans un même ouvrage
51 @subsection Plusieurs partitions dans un même ouvrage
52 @translationof Multiple scores in a book
53
54 @untranslated
55
56
57 @node Structure de fichier
58 @subsection Structure de fichier
59 @translationof File structure
60
61 @untranslated
62
63
64 @node Titres et entêtes
65 @section Titres et entêtes
66 @translationof Titles and headers
67
68 @untranslated
69
70
71 @menu
72 * Création de titres::             
73 * Titres personnalisés::               
74 * Référencement des numéros de page::   
75 * Table des matières::           
76 @end menu
77
78 @node Création de titres
79 @subsection Création de titres
80 @translationof Creating titles
81
82 @untranslated
83
84
85 @node Titres personnalisés
86 @subsection Titres personnalisés
87 @translationof Custom titles
88
89 @untranslated
90
91
92 @node Référencement des numéros de page
93 @subsection Référencement des numéros de page
94 @translationof Reference to page numbers
95
96 @untranslated
97
98
99 @node Table des matières
100 @subsection Table des matières
101 @translationof Table of contents
102
103 @untranslated
104
105
106 @node Travail sur des fichiers texte
107 @section Travail sur des fichiers texte
108 @translationof Working with input files
109
110 @untranslated
111
112
113 @menu
114 * Insertion de fichiers LilyPond::    
115 * Différentes éditions à partir d'une même source::  
116 * Codage du texte::               
117 * Affichage de notation au format LilyPond::  
118 @end menu
119
120 @node Insertion de fichiers LilyPond
121 @subsection Insertion de fichiers LilyPond
122 @translationof Including LilyPond files
123
124 @untranslated
125
126
127 @node Différentes éditions à partir d'une même source
128 @subsection Différentes éditions à partir d'une même source
129 @translationof Different editions from one source
130
131 @untranslated
132
133
134 @menu
135 * Utilisation de variables::             
136 * Utilisation de balises::                  
137 @end menu
138
139 @node Utilisation de variables
140 @unnumberedsubsubsec Utilisation de variables
141 @translationof Using variables
142
143 @untranslated
144
145
146 @node Utilisation de balises
147 @unnumberedsubsubsec Utilisation de balises
148 @translationof Using tags
149 @funindex \tag
150 @cindex tag
151  
152 La commande @code{\tag} affecte un nom à des expressions musicales.
153 Les expressions ainsi balisées pourront être filtrées par la suite.
154 Ce mécanisme permet d'obtenir différentes versions à partir d'une même
155 source musicale. 
156
157 Dans l'exemple qui suit, nous obtenons deux versions du même extrait,
158 l'une pour le conducteur, l'autre pour l'instrumentiste, et qui
159 comportera les ornements. 
160  
161 @example
162 c1
163 <<
164   \tag #'partie <<
165     R1 \\
166     @{
167       \set fontSize = #-1
168       c4_"cue" f2 g4 @}
169   >>
170   \tag #'conducteur R1
171 >>
172 c1
173 @end example
174
175 @noindent
176 Ce principe peut s'appliquer aux articulations, textes, etc.  Il
177 suffit de positionner
178
179 @example
180 -\tag #@var{votre-balise}
181 @end example
182
183 @noindent
184 avant l'articulation, comme ici :
185
186 @example
187 c1-\tag #'part ^4
188 @end example
189
190 @noindent 
191 Ceci définira une note avec une indication de doigté conditionnelle.
192  
193 @cindex keepWithTag
194 @cindex removeWithTag
195 C'est grâce aux commandes @code{\keepWithTag} et @code{\removeWithTag}
196 que vous filtrerez les expressions balisées.  Par exemple :
197
198 @example
199 <<
200   @var{de la musique}
201   \keepWithTag #'score @var{de la musique}
202   \keepWithTag #'part @var{de la musique}
203 >>
204 @end example
205
206 @noindent
207 donnerait :
208
209 @lilypondfile[ragged-right,quote]{tag-filter.ly}
210
211 Les arguments de la commande @code{\tag} doivent être un symbole (tel
212 que @code{#'score} ou @code{#'part}), suivi d'une expression musicale.
213 Vous pouvez utiliser de multiples balises dans un morceau en
214 saisissant plusieurs @code{\tag}.
215  
216 @example
217 \tag #'original-part \tag #'transposed-part @dots{}
218 @end example
219
220 @ignore
221 FIXME
222 @seealso
223 Exemples : @lsr{parts,tag@/-filter@/.ly}
224 @end ignore
225
226
227 @knownissues
228
229 Lorsqu'elles comportent des silences, ceux-ci ne seront pas fusionnés
230 si vous imprimez une partition avec les deux sections balisées.
231
232
233 @node Codage du texte
234 @subsection Codage du texte
235 @translationof Text encoding
236
237 @untranslated
238
239
240 @node Affichage de notation au format LilyPond
241 @subsection Affichage de notation au format LilyPond
242 @translationof Displaying LilyPond notation
243
244 @untranslated
245
246
247 @node Contrôle des sorties
248 @section Contrôle des sorties
249 @translationof Controlling output
250
251 @untranslated
252
253
254 @menu
255 * Extraction de fragments musicaux::  
256 * Ignorer des passages de la partition::    
257 @end menu
258
259 @node Extraction de fragments musicaux
260 @subsection Extraction de fragments musicaux
261 @translationof Extracting fragments of music
262
263 @untranslated
264
265
266 @node Ignorer des passages de la partition
267 @subsection Ignorer des passages de la partition
268 @translationof Skipping corrected music
269
270 @untranslated
271
272
273 @node Sortie MIDI
274 @section Sortie MIDI
275 @translationof MIDI output
276
277 @untranslated
278
279
280 @menu
281 * Création de fichiers MIDI::         
282 * Le bloc MIDI::                  
283 * Contenu de la sortie MIDI::  
284 * Répétitions et MIDI::             
285 * Gestion des nuances en MIDI::   
286 * MIDI et percussions::
287 @end menu
288
289 @node Création de fichiers MIDI
290 @subsection Création de fichiers MIDI
291 @translationof Creating MIDI files
292
293 @untranslated
294
295
296 @unnumberedsubsubsec Noms d'instrument
297 @node Le bloc MIDI
298 @subsection Le bloc MIDI
299 @translationof MIDI block
300
301 @untranslated
302
303
304 @node Contenu de la sortie MIDI
305 @subsection Contenu de la sortie MIDI
306 @translationof What goes into the MIDI output?
307
308 @untranslated
309
310
311 @unnumberedsubsubsec Éléments pris en compte dans le MIDI
312 @unnumberedsubsubsec Éléments non pris en compte dans le MIDI
313
314 @node Répétitions et MIDI
315 @subsection Répétitions et MIDI
316 @translationof Repeats in MIDI
317
318 @cindex reprises développées
319 @funindex \unfoldRepeats
320
321 Au prix de quelques réglages, les reprises de toutes sortes peuvent être
322 rendues dans le fichier MIDI.  Il suffit pour cela de recourir à la
323 fonction @code{\unfoldRepeats}, qui développe toutes les reprises.  En
324 d'autre termes, @code{\unfoldRepeats} transforme toutes les reprises
325 en reprises de type @code{unfold}.
326
327
328 @lilypond[quote,verbatim,fragment,line-width=8.0\cm]
329 \unfoldRepeats {
330   \repeat tremolo 8 {c'32 e' }
331   \repeat percent 2 { c''8 d'' }
332   \repeat volta 2 {c'4 d' e' f'}
333   \alternative {
334     { g' a' a' g' }
335     {f' e' d' c' }
336   }
337 }
338 \bar "|."
339 @end lilypond
340
341
342 Lorsque l'on veut utiliser @code{\unfoldRepeats} seulement pour le rendu
343 MIDI, il faut établir deux blocs @code{\score} : un pour le MIDI, avec
344 des reprises explicites, et l'autre pour la partition, avec des reprises
345 notées sous forme de barres de reprise, de trémolo ou de symboles de
346 pourcentage.  Par exemple
347
348 @example
349 \score @{
350  @var{..musique..}
351  \layout @{ ..  @}
352 @}
353 \score @{
354  \unfoldRepeats @var{..musique..}
355  \midi @{ ..  @}
356 @}
357 @end example
358
359
360 @node Gestion des nuances en MIDI
361 @subsection Gestion des nuances en MIDI
362 @translationof Controlling MIDI dynamics
363
364 @untranslated
365
366
367 @unnumberedsubsubsec Indications de nuance
368 @unnumberedsubsubsec Amplitude du volume en MIDI
369 @unnumberedsubsubsec Égalisation de plusieurs instruments (i)
370 @unnumberedsubsubsec Égalisation de plusieurs instruments (ii)
371
372
373 @node MIDI et percussions
374 @subsection MIDI et percussions
375 @translationof Percussion in MIDI
376
377 @untranslated
378